We have used forward ballistic, reverse ballistic and computational analysis techniques to interrogate the effect of the gilding jacket from a 7.62 mm × 51 mm FFV armour-piercing bullet during the penetration of ceramic-faced targets. When the gilding jacket is removed, it is shown that greater damage occurs to the core suggesting that the presence of the jacket is pre-damaging the ceramic before core arrival. This is confirmed through computational analysis. This work highlights possibilities in enhancing protection by pre-stripping the bullet's jacket prior to ceramic impact.
► Effect of bullet jacket on penetration mechanics into ceramic targets studied.
► Both forward-ballistic and reverse-ballistic experiments have been carried out.
► Flash X-ray used to capture penetration morphology of 7.62 mm FFV jacket.
► A bullet's gilding jacket pre-damages the ceramic prior to core arrival.
